At LIGHTFAIR® International (LFI®), LEDVANCE, the maker of SYLVANIA general lighting in the United States and Canada, is showing how SYLVANIA LED lighting products are advancing light in renovation, making the company the best retrofit partner for quality lighting products for any purpose, commercial and residential, at Booth 2101. LEDVANCE LLC offers a wide range of SYLVANIA LED luminaires for various applications, intelligent lighting products for Smart Homes and Buildings, one of the largest LED lamps portfolios in the industry, and traditional light sources.  Celebrating its 30th anniversary this year from May 21 – 23 in Philadelphia, LFI is the world’s largest annual architectural and commercial lighting trade show and conference.

“LEDVANCE stands for advancing light together with our distributor partners in a connected world.  The latest SYLVANIA general lighting innovations have been showcased at LIGHTFAIR since the event’s beginning.  For the trade show’s 30th anniversary, we are excited to be up in front to show the industry how we help provide ‘Light Where You Need It’ as a result of our growing portfolio of LED lamps and luminaires that are ideal for numerous vertical applications,” said Lawrence Lin, global CEO and acting managing director for the USC region, LEDVANCE. 

“LEDVANCE is one of the fastest-growing LED luminaire providers in North America,” said Lin.  “This year, part of our booth will focus on our extended SYLVANIA indoor and outdoor luminaire portfolio which includes many IoT-ready form factors designed to support distributors in being a resource for new controls-related applications.”

Some of the new SYLVANIA LED lamps and luminaires being shown at LFI include:

  • Controls integration into SYLVANIA LED Luminaires with leading industry partners and open protocol Zigbee compatible systems,  
  • SYLVANIA Wall Packs with field adjustable wattage selection,
  • The first of its kind SYLVANIA SMART+ A19 Filament Tunable White Lamp,
  • SYLVANIA SMART+ PAR 38 Night Chaser, the industry-first, dimmable smart PAR LED lamp that delivers the highest lumen and center beam candle power outputs,
  • SYLVANIA UltraLED™ Select RT with three color temperatures and two lumen levels selectable directly on the downlights,
  • SYLVANIA UltraLED RT Downlight Series with emergency battery backup, and 
  • Cost-effective SYLVANIA LED Luminaires with superior color rendition technology for color critical lighting applications, providing outstanding quality of light at affordable prices.
